Directed by Rob Cohen, this high-octane thriller stars Vin Diesel as Xander Cage, an extreme sports athlete recruited by the NSA to infiltrate a Russian terrorist group called Anarchy 99. Starring: Vin Diesel, Asia Argento, and Samuel L. Jackson.
Plot: Cage must use his adrenaline-fueled skills to stop a biological weapon strike in Prague.
Impact: The film was a major box office success, grossing over $277 million and spawning two sequels. Understanding the Search Keywords

For those looking to watch the 2002 film xXx (Triple X), starring Vin Diesel, here is the essential information regarding the movie and its legal availability in India. Movie Overview: xXx (2002)
The film follows Xander Cage (Vin Diesel), a thrill-seeking extreme sports enthusiast who is recruited by the NSA to infiltrate a Russian criminal organization in Prague.
Starring: Vin Diesel, Asia Argento, Samuel L. Jackson, and Marton Csokas. Director: Rob Cohen. Genre: Action, Adventure, Mystery & Thriller. Release Date: August 9, 2002.
Languages: Originally released in English. It is widely available with Hindi-dubbed audio on many platforms. Legal Streaming & Download Options in India
